What will I learn?

Gain essential skills in Fourier series to break down periodic signals, calculate coefficients, explore convergence including Gibbs phenomenon and harmonic decay. Build filters, control bandwidth, and validate computations using Python or MATLAB. Straightforward explanations, step-by-step methods, and practical checklists enable swift application from theory to real engineering solutions.

Develop skills

  • Master Fourier coefficients: derive Ck, an, bn for piecewise 2π-periodic signals.
  • Analyze harmonic spectra: connect decay rates, smoothness, and energy distribution.
  • Design practical filters: set cutoff, ripple, and attenuation from Fourier data.
  • Implement partial sums: compute, plot, and verify series in Python or MATLAB.
  • Diagnose convergence: interpret Gibbs, symmetry, and error versus number of harmonics.
